Hotel la Ninfa is a lodging, located at Via Mauro Comite, 35, 84011 Amalfi SA, Italy. They can be contacted via phone at +39 089 831127, visit their website www.hotellaninfa.it for more detailed information.

    Superb location and view. Good connectivity with bus and walkable distance from Amalfi coast if one is without luggage. From the hotel to Amalfi is doable with trolley luggage as well as it's a downhill 1km

    Good place and very good hospitality and service and above average breakfast. View is the king and connectivity of roads is great. Has tabacchi nearby and free wi-fi

    We have traveled quite a bit and this was the worst hotel either of us had ever stayed in. The staff was rude and unhelpful. Not one single time was a staff member at the front desk when we walked through the lobby, and yet we were expected to leave our room keys and car keys there when we left to explore amalfi. Although it says free parking, parking is in fact 20€ per night. If you ask about the laws in amalfi for parking on the street, you'll get a snide, rude response that is completely unhelpful. If you want to open the garage, you will require a master's degree in engineering to
    figure out how those doors work. The room was absolutely filthy. The blanket was covered in what looked like grease stains. It was so disgusting. There was mold all over the walls, stray pubic hairs and what looked like makeup and food stains covering every surface. Even though we booked a superior room, this was the smallest room I've ever seen. (Maybe 10 sq meters) There were no nightstands and no place to put our suitcases. The room looked like a bomb exploded as soon as we tried to find anything in our bags.

    When we checked out, there was no manager on duty. The woman who cleans rooms/makes breakfast had to check us out, but unfortunately she speaks no English. She demanded exact change for our extra charges and didn't want us to charge it on a card. This is not her fault, there should have been a manager there as this is not her job.

    Take your money somewhere else. We also stayed in an airbnb for a few nights and this experience was so much better with better value.

    It's very romantic, tiny, perched on top of the cliff. I can only speak for room 8, which is a stand-alone satellite to the hotel. Room is clean, A/C powerful, view gorgeous. The staff is friendly and helpful. A word of caution: though it says breakfast is till 10 am if you come at 9am or later food will be gone and not replaced. However, if you go earlier, all seats are taken. Hence four stars out of five.
